We need to find the ngle formed by the line of sight with the horizontal when the object viewed is below the horizontal level.
When the angle viewed by the observer is below the horizontal line, the angle made by the line of sight of the observer with the horizontal line is the angle of depression.

Corresponding angles are those which are present at the same corner when a line cuts two lines. The corresponding angles are equal to each other.
Angle of elevation is the angle made by the line of sight of the observer with the horizontal line when the object is above the horizontal line.
